The Compañía de Vinos de Telmo Rodríguez wine firm has travelled far and wide in Spain to discover a complex country of wines with incredibly diverse, rich and unique winemaking landscapes. They have based their project on understanding how previous generations worked, using only local grape varieties, recovering long-lost vineyards, finding the best areas for production and creating terroir wines which interpret historic vines in a natural way.
Pegaso was born in 1999 as part of a project seeking out old Grenache vines in the Sierra de Gredos hills and working to ensure their survival in the extreme landscape and climate of Cebreros, one of the most recently registered DO appellations in Spain. They bought their first vines here, wonderful Grenache plants left to grow wild at a forgotten and hard-to-work site located at an altitude over 1000 metres above sea level. The slate seam they found at Arrebatacapas, unique in the Gredos region, showed promise that great wines could be created here.
Their simplest and most accessible wine, Pegaso Zeta, was born 20 years later from old vines cultivated by the firm and their suppliers using organic agriculture methods. Grapes are harvested by hand and the fermented wine is aged for six months in 500-litre French wooden barrels before standing for a further 6 months in stainless steel tanks. It may be a simple wine, but it is brimming with personality – a small, yet great wine.
In the glass, Pegaso Zeta displays a claret-cherry colour with a low-medium intensity, and dense translucent legs. A gentle nose of ripe red fruits, herbal aromas like bay leaves and other spices, and earthy hints give it a rustic feel while the granite and slate of Gredos produce mineral aromas. It is pure pleasure in the mouth; an intense, fresh and deep wine with a certain degree of bitterness highlighting toasted notes, red fruit, silky tannins and, once again, a welcoming rusticity making it a very moreish wine.
